I use Carvin pickups on the neck & middle. On Strats not using Carvins I Mexican Strat pickups. Carvins have 6 pole pieces so there is no dropout when bending. The Mexican Strat pickups have a more midrange.
For the bridge, if I am not going SSS and wire SSH instead, I use a Dimarzio HB or a Semour Duncan HB in the bridge position.
